    The Astros beating the Rangers 9/13 to secure tiebreakers was out of Dusty’s control? The Astros winning 5/6 to end the season to overcome a 2.5 game deficit in the division was out of Dusty’s control?

    The Astros didn’t roll to a double-digit division title, as they’ve done the past six years - but they did weather several potentially season -changing stretches by the Rangers & Mariners, never falling too far behind & being in position to take advantage of late stumbles.

    And that’s the primary job of a manager - to lead a team through a long, difficult, unpredictable season.

    Dusty can be frustrating in the micro (though I truly believe nitpicking line-ups is silly) - but I think he manages the macro very well. He took a team reeling from a potentially franchise-altering scandal, and didn’t just right the ship - he kept the team focused and winning. They’ve lost players, draft picks; guys have gotten older, less healthy… and here they are: one win away from their third pennant in four years (and they were a game 7 away from it being 4/4), a run that is significantly better than Hinch’s.

    To think ALL that is in spite of Dusty Baker is just flat-out silly.
